ytmdl
A simple app to get songs from YouTube in mp3 format with artist name, album name etc from sources like iTunes, Spotify, LastFM, Deezer, Gaana etc.

inaSpeechSegmenter
CNN-based audio segmentation toolkit. Allows to detect speech, music, noise and speaker gender. Has been designed for large scale gender equality studies based on speech time per gender.

Nope it's not. If you take a look at what's under the hood you'll see that it actually uses ytmdl which, no doubt uses youtube-dl but it is way more than just a wrapper. It allows a lot more features that youtube-dl and supports various metadata providers, formats, playlist supports etc.
After looking for a few options, I came across inaSpeechSegmenter. It is a speech segmenter and if you pass it an audio file, it returns the time segments of noises and music.
